A car travels the first 50 km of its journey at an average speed of 25 m/s and the next 120 km at an On his outward journey, Ali travelled at a speed of s km/h for 2.5 hours. On his return journey, he increased his speed by 4 km/h and saved 15 minutes. Find Ali's average speed for the whole journey. Speed of 80 km/h. The car completes the last part of its journey at an average speed of 90 km/h in 35 minutes. Find the average speed for its entire journey, giving your answer in km/h.

Answers

Answer:

The car's average speed for the entire journey = 84.315 km/h

Step-by-step explanation:

Correct Question

A car travels the first 50km of its journey at an average speed of 25m/s and the next 120 km at an average speed of 80km/h. the car completes the last part of its journey at an average speed of 90km/h in 35 minutes. Find the average speed for its entire journey, giving your answer in km/h.

Solution

Average speed is given as total distance travelled divided by total time taken.

So, we will compute the distance covered for each part of the journey and the corresponding time it takes to cover each of these distances.

- The car travels the 50 km first part of the journey at a speed of 25 m/s.

25 m/s = 90 km/h

We have the distance covered in the first part of the journey, now, we need the time taken to cover the distance.

Speed = (Distance/Time)

Time = (Distance/Speed)

Distance = 50 km, Speed = 90 km/h

Time = (50/90) = 0.5556 hr

- The next part, the car covers 120 km at a speed of 80 km/h

Time = (Distance/Speed) = (120/80) = 1.5 hr

- For the last part of the journey, the car travels with an average speed of 90 km/h for 35 minutes.

35 minutes = (35/60) hr = 0.5833 hr

Here, we need to calculate the distance covered for the last part.

Speed = (Distance/Time)

Distance = (Speed) × (Time) = 90 × 0.5833 = 52.5 km

Total distance covered = 50 + 120 + 52.5 = 222.5 km

Total time taken = 0.5556 + 1.5 + 0.5833 = 2.6389 hr

Average Speed = (222.5/2.6389) = 84.315 km/h

A SQUARE CARPET IS LAID IN ONE CORNER OF A RECTANGULAR ROOM, LEAVING STRIPS OF UNCOVERED FLOOR 2M WIDE ALONG ONE SIDE AND 1M ALONG OTHER . THE AREA OF THE ROOM IS 56m SQUARED .FIND THE DIMENSIONS OF THE CARPET

Answers

Answer:

Step-by-step explanation:

A square has equal sides. Let x represent the length of each side of the square carpet. The diagram representing the room and the carpet is shown in the attached photo. Therefore, the length of the room would be (x + 2)m while the width of the room would be (x + 1)m

Since the area of the room is 56m², it means that

(x + 2)(x + 1) = 56

x² + x + 2x + 2 = 56

x² + 3x + 2 - 56 = 0

x² + 3x - 54 = 0

x² + 9x - 6x - 54 = 0

x(x + 9) - 6(x + 9) = 0

x - 6 = 0 or x + 9 = 0

x = 6 or x = - 9

Since the dimension of the carpet cannot be negative, then x = 6

The dimension of the carpet is 6m × 6m

Let R be the relation on the set of ordered pairs of positive integers such that ((a, b), (c, d)) ∈ R if and only if ad = bc. Arrange the proof of the given statement in correct order to show that R is an equivalence relation. (Prove the given relation is reflexive first, and then symmetric and transitive.)

Answers

Answer:

The given relation R is equivalence relation.

Step-by-step explanation:

Given that:

[tex]((a, b), (c, d))\in R[/tex]

Where [tex]R[/tex] is the relation on the set of ordered pairs of positive integers.

To prove, a relation R to be equivalence relation we need to prove that the relation is reflexive, symmetric and transitive.

1. First of all, let us check reflexive property:

Reflexive property means:

[tex]\forall a \in A \Rightarrow (a,a) \in R[/tex]

Here we need to prove:

[tex]\forall (a, b) \in A \Rightarrow ((a,b), (a,b)) \in R[/tex]

As per the given relation:

[tex]((a,b), (a,b) ) \Rightarrow ab =ab[/tex] which is true.

[tex]\therefore[/tex] R is reflexive.

2. Now, let us check symmetric property:

Symmetric property means:

[tex]\forall \{a,b\} \in A\ if\ (a,b) \in R \Rightarrow (b,a) \in R[/tex]

Here we need to prove:

[tex]\forall {(a, b),(c,d)} \in A \ if\ ((a,b),(c,d)) \in R \Rightarrow ((c,d),(a,b)) \in R[/tex]

As per the given relation:

[tex]((a,b),(c,d)) \in R[/tex] means [tex]ad = bc[/tex]

[tex]((c,d),(a,b)) \in R[/tex] means [tex]cb = da\ or\ ad =bc[/tex]

Hence true.

[tex]\therefore[/tex] R is symmetric.

3. R to be transitive, we need to prove:

[tex]if ((a,b),(c,d)),((c,d),(e,f)) \in R \Rightarrow ((a,b),(e,f)) \in R[/tex]

[tex]((a,b),(c,d)) \in R[/tex] means [tex]ad = cb[/tex].... (1)

[tex]((c,d), (e,f)) \in R[/tex] means [tex]fc = ed[/tex] ...... (2)

To prove:

To be [tex]((a,b), (e,f)) \in R[/tex] we need to prove: [tex]fa = be[/tex]

Multiply (1) with (2):

[tex]adcf = bcde\\\Rightarrow fa = be[/tex]

So, R is transitive as well.

Hence proved that R is an equivalence relation.
